This isn't a tutorial, just a tip on themes.

1.) 

Decide what you want your theme to look like.

What colours, what styles, what fonts?

The important thing is that it works for each and every book.

2.)

What books?

I highly suggest that if you have Random books and novels/poetry that you don't use the same theme, because it makes it harder to discern what's a novel and what's random.

If  all your books are the same genre brilliant!

And if they're different...it means you will have to change the theme to something much more basic. For example, check out hepburnette's cover theme.

3.)

Matching.

Use similar looking images. Try to have the same coloured background, the same font and similar angles.
